The hexadecimal color code #41645C corresponds to the code RGB( 65, 100, 92 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,25 level), green (at 0,39 level) and blue (at 0,36 level). Its brightness is 32% and its saturation is 21%. It is composed of red at 25%, green at 38% and blue at 35%.

Uses of #41645C in CSS

When using #41645C as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#41645C as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
